clock gable
English
Etymology
A calque of Dutch klokgevel, with klok meaning both bell and clock in Dutch, and gevel meaning gable.
Noun
clock gable (plural clock gables)
- a gable or facade with a decorative bell-shape, characteristic of traditional Dutch architecture
